Description

This publication focuses on the importance of skills supply to demand from an efficiency perspective as well distributional perspective. It features results from the ILO’s Skills for Trade and Economic Diversification (STED) programme, illustrating how proper skills development policies are vital in helping firms participate in trade, and also facilitate workers in finding good jobs.
